Muffin Tin (Cup) Monday
stumbled across this fun idea last night while browsing the internet (instead of getting to bed at a reasonable hour!!) and thought it sounded like fun. http://michellesjournalcorner.blogspot.com/2010/03/muffin-tin-monday.html Muffin Tin Mom posts themes for these fun little lunches (this week was a free theme week) and lots of other moms share what they serve the kids. I don't have any small muffin tin pans so I just used cupcake liners instead. :)
I think this is a neat idea because it makes lunch a little different and fun, it helps teach portion control, and can encourage them to try new foods depending on the theme and my creativity. :) Anyhow, not sure I will do it every week...but I think we'll give it a shot! I didn't have much time to plan so I just used what was easy today. We have hummus, baby carrots, goldfish, pb banana sandwiches and hame rolled up with some cream cheese.
